India and Fintech

 

India has been the main participant in the fintech revolution that is sweeping the world. A recent global survey about Fintech adoption Index conducted by Ernst & Young shows that India is the second country to adopt fintech @ 52% following China which is at the top @ 69% (Source: http://www.yesfintech.com/data/cms/ifor-report-2018.pdf). Reportedly, there are more than 1200 fintech firms in India and the numbers are poised to grow (Source: https://taxguru.in/rbi/opportunities-challenges-fintech.html).

 

However, the fintech sector in India also has its share of challenges. Some of them include the following –

  • Raising sufficient capital
  • Regulatory bodies which impose various laws and red tapes for the fintech to navigate through
  • Cybersecurity
  • Customers’ lack of trust in the online medium
  • Low penetration of internet

 

Despite these challenges, the fintech industry is slowly booming. Though the challenges are slowing down the growth, the growth is steady.

 

RBI’s role in financial inclusion

 

Seeing the impact of fintechs, the Reserve Bank of India has also been taking steps to promote fintechs among consumers. After the Government’s move of demonetization, RBI has increasingly aimed at making the market cashless. Digital payment modes are being promoted with new and innovative solutions being designed for customers for paying for their transactions. Recently, the RBI presented a framework for ‘regulatory sandbox’.

 

A regulatory sandbox would be a live and controlled environment which would allow fintechs to test their new products on a limited scale before they present it to the world. Since the testing would be of a limited scale, in case of a negative response, the fintech would face lower losses and the costs are also reduced. This would also give fintechs a ‘safe zone’ to test their products. This regulatory sandbox concept would be a great push for fintechs to develop in a cost-effective way.
